Text: | O Spirit of Grace |
Author: | Nicholas L. von Zinzendorf, 1700-1760 |
Translator: | Philip Henry Molther, 1714-1780 |
Tune: | NEANDER |
Composer: | Joachim Neander, 1650-1680 |
1 O Spirit of grace,
Thy kindness we trace
In showing to us
That life and salvation proceed from Christ’s Cross.
2 In darkness we strayed
Until we were led
By Thee to believe
That Jesus, our Savior, will sinners receive.
3 Grant us to obey
Thy teaching, we pray,
O Spirit of love,
And thankful to Thee for Thy mercies to prove.
